Command Development for Claude Code

Overview

Slash commands are frequently-used prompts defined as Markdown files that Claude executes during interactive sessions. Understanding command structure, frontmatter options, and dynamic features enables creating powerful, reusable workflows.

Key concepts:

  • Markdown file format for commands
  • YAML frontmatter for configuration
  • Dynamic arguments and file references
  • Bash execution for context
  • Command organization and namespacing
